In 2021, cybersecurity authorities across the globe observed an increase in sophisticated, high-impact ransomware incidents against critical infrastructure organisations. The Australian Cyber Security Centre (ACSC) observed continued ransomware targeting of Australian critical infrastructure entities, including healthcare, financial services, and energy sectors, and observed a 15-percent increase in ransomware cybercrime reports in the 2020-2021 financial year.
Ransomware threat actors are continuing to evolve their tactics, techniques and procedures in 2022, looking to bring double extortion techniques and ransomware-as-a-service models to Linux and cloud systems.
